Hi,<br><br><br><div><span class="gmail_quote">2008/1/12, Ashley Devarim &lt;<a href="mailto:ashley_devarim@hotmail.com">ashley_devarim@hotmail.com</a>&gt;:</span><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
<br>Hi Gaters,<br><br>Please, I&#39;m using a phoswich detector in a cylindrical PET scanner. and I need to ask you a question, is it forbidden to use depth value = 5 in the coincidence sorter :<br>/gate/digitizer/Coincidences/setDepth 5
</blockquote><div><br>No it is not forbidden but if you have defined only 3 depths in your cylindricalPET (for example : the cylindricalPET, rsectors and crystals), depth number 5 does not exist. I am not sure of that and I can&#39;t verify it as I am not at work ;-) But if my memory is good, I already had this problem.
<br><br>If the problem persists, send your macro.<br>Cheers,<br>Simon<br></div><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">because when i choose this value, the simulation doesn&#39;t finish, it stops and gives the following message :
<br><br><br>*** Break *** floating point exception<br> Generating stack trace...<br> 0x082625f8 in GateCoincidenceSorter::ComputeSectorID(GatePulse const&amp;) + 0x188 from /usr/local/gate/bin/Linux-g++/Gate<br> 0x0826354f in GateCoincidenceSorter::IsForbiddenCoincidence(GatePulse const&amp;, GatePulse const&amp;) + 0x15f from /usr/local/gate/bin/Linux-g++/Gate
<br> 0x08264bcc in GateCoincidenceSorter::CoincidentPulseIsValid(GateCoincidencePulse*, bool) + 0x11c from /usr/local/gate/bin/Linux-g++/Gate<br> 0x082652e2 in GateCoincidenceSorter::ProcessSinglePulseList(GatePulseList*) + 0x642 from /usr/local/gate/bin/Linux-g++/Gate
<br> 0x081d2e4d in GateDigitizer::Digitize() + 0x1ad from /usr/local/gate/bin/Linux-g++/Gate<br> 0x081ec1e8 in GateOutputMgr::RecordEndOfEvent(G4Event const*) + 0x58 from /usr/local/gate/bin/Linux-g++/Gate<br> 0x081df89a in GateEventAction::EndOfEventAction(G4Event const*) + 0x2a from /usr/local/gate/bin/Linux-g++/Gate
<br> 0x087cc6f3 in G4EventManager::DoProcessing(G4Event*) + 0x5c3 from /usr/local/gate/bin/Linux-g++/Gate<br> 0x086d493a in G4RunManager::DoEventLoop(int, char const*, int) + 0xba from /usr/local/gate/bin/Linux-g++/Gate<br>
 0x086d1f8d in G4RunManager::BeamOn(int, char const*, int) + 0x5d from /usr/local/gate/bin/Linux-g++/Gate<br> 0x081c93bf in GateApplicationMgr::StartDAQ() + 0xdf from /usr/local/gate/bin/Linux-g++/Gate<br> 0x081c9ac2 in GateApplicationMgrMessenger::SetNewValue(G4UIcommand*, G4String) + 0x122 from /usr/local/gate/bin/Linux-g++/Gate
<br> 0x0895005f in G4UIcommand::DoIt(G4String) + 0xa3f from /usr/local/gate/bin/Linux-g++/Gate<br> 0x08956e57 in G4UImanager::ApplyCommand(char const*) + 0x4f7 from /usr/local/gate/bin/Linux-g++/Gate<br> 0x08963601 in G4UIbatch::SessionStart() + 0x1e1 from /usr/local/gate/bin/Linux-g++/Gate
<br> 0x089557f1 in G4UImanager::ExecuteMacroFile(char const*) + 0x41 from /usr/local/gate/bin/Linux-g++/Gate<br> 0x08964916 in G4UIcontrolMessenger::SetNewValue(G4UIcommand*, G4String) + 0xe6 from /usr/local/gate/bin/Linux-g++/Gate
<br> 0x0895005f in G4UIcommand::DoIt(G4String) + 0xa3f from /usr/local/gate/bin/Linux-g++/Gate<br> 0x08956e57 in G4UImanager::ApplyCommand(char const*) + 0x4f7 from /usr/local/gate/bin/Linux-g++/Gate<br> 0x08963601 in G4UIbatch::SessionStart() + 0x1e1 from /usr/local/gate/bin/Linux-g++/Gate
<br> 0x089557f1 in G4UImanager::ExecuteMacroFile(char const*) + 0x41 from /usr/local/gate/bin/Linux-g++/Gate<br> 0x0822fbb1 in GateUIcontrolMessenger::LaunchMacroFile(G4String) + 0x91 from /usr/local/gate/bin/Linux-g++/Gate
<br> 0x0822fd08 in GateUIcontrolMessenger::SetNewValue(G4UIcommand*, G4String) + 0x98 from /usr/local/gate/bin/Linux-g++/Gate<br> 0x0895005f in G4UIcommand::DoIt(G4String) + 0xa3f from /usr/local/gate/bin/Linux-g++/Gate<br>
 0x08956e57 in G4UImanager::ApplyCommand(char const*) + 0x4f7 from /usr/local/gate/bin/Linux-g++/Gate<br> 0x081c7e0b in main + 0x34b from /usr/local/gate/bin/Linux-g++/Gate<br> 0x0663df70 in __libc_start_main + 0xe0 from /lib/libc.so.6
<br> 0x081c6891 in TCanvasImp::Streamer(TBuffer&amp;) + 0x35 from /usr/local/gate/bin/Linux-g++/Gate<br>/usr/bin/Gate: line 7:&nbsp;&nbsp;4778 Abandon&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; $GATEDIR/bin/Linux-g++/Gate $1<br><br><br>Do you know the explanation please ?
<br><br>Thank you very much<br>Ashley<br>_________________________________________________________________<br>Viens lire ce que Père Noël est en train de faire! Pour les plus récentes nouvelles du Pôle Nord, visite <a href="http://demandeauperenoel.spaces.live.com">
demandeauperenoel.spaces.live.com</a><br><a href="http://demandeauperenoel.spaces.live.com/_______________________________________________">http://demandeauperenoel.spaces.live.com/_______________________________________________
</a><br>Gate-users mailing list<br><a href="mailto:Gate-users@lists.healthgrid.org">Gate-users@lists.healthgrid.org</a><br><a href="http://lists.healthgrid.org/mailman/listinfo/gate-users">http://lists.healthgrid.org/mailman/listinfo/gate-users
</a><br></blockquote></div><br>